Frequencies Below 1 Hz Any EEG value below 1 is not AC EEG that we train.  It’s DC. It’s not produced in the cortex, nor even in the brain’s subcortical areas, as are the AC frequencies.  It appears to be a signal from the brainstem.  The published research that’s been done, or at least what I’ve seen, has been done on Slow Cortical Potentials (SCP) which range from about .3 to about .8 Hz, and it was done by serious […]
